Sardinian Warble - Sylvia melanocephala

A rare vigranrt in Britain, the Sardinian Warbler is relatively common in southern Europe around the Mediterranean. The male has a black head contrasting with the white throat, whilst the female has more subdued plumage with a brown head. Both have red eye rings.
